Official Notification and Key Events
- Official notification announces exam schedule and application details.
- The application process allows eligible candidates to register online.
- The admit card release confirms the examination date and test center.
- Examination day completes the written assessment stage.

After the Examination Process
- Answer key release helps candidates estimate probable scores.
- Result declaration confirms qualification for counselling participation.
- The counselling process begins after the publication of the results and ranks.
- Admission concludes with document verification and seat allotment.
